Hydro Flask Manufacturing
Location
Hydro Flask bottles are manufactured in China. The majority of production occurs in Zhejiang Province, with additional facilities in Guangdong, Jiangsu, and Shanghai. The company headquarters remain in Bend, Oregon, USA, but manufacturing is outsourced to specialized Chinese factories. Most Hydro Flask bottles display a “Made in China” label on the bottom, confirming their origin. The former CEO of Hydro Flask has publicly stated that the brand relies on Chinese manufacturing for its insulated stainless steel water bottles. China produces approximately 95% of the world’s insulated bottles, making it the leading hub for this industry.

Design vs. Production
Hydro Flask bottles are designed in the United States. The design team in Oregon focuses on innovation, user experience, and product aesthetics. After the design phase, production shifts to China, where factories use advanced manufacturing techniques to create the bottles. This separation allows Hydro Flask to maintain high standards in design while leveraging the expertise and scale of Chinese manufacturers for production. The company has explored nearshoring options, which could bring some manufacturing closer to the USA in the future. Nearshoring may improve supply chain efficiency and reduce shipping times, but most current production remains in China.

Authenticity
Genuine vs. Counterfeit
Many consumers struggle to distinguish genuine Hydro Flask bottles from counterfeits. Counterfeiters often create products that look similar but fail to meet the brand’s quality standards. Common signs of fake bottles include misspelled website URLs, such as hydroflsak.com, and poor product quality. Some bottles show condensation on the outside when filled with cold water, which means they lack proper insulation. Low-quality plastic lids and rubber rings that fall out easily also indicate a counterfeit. The finish and logo may look different from authentic products. Counterfeit bottles often ship directly from China and are sold through professional-looking but fraudulent websites or social media ads. Many buyers report delayed or missing deliveries, poor customer service, and difficulties obtaining refunds.
Tip: Watch for unusual fonts, incorrect color labels, or prices that seem too good to be true. These are often signs of a fake product.
How to Check
Buyers can take several steps to verify the authenticity of a Hydro Flask bottle. First, check the product label and packaging for spelling errors or inconsistencies. Authentic bottles display a clear “Made in China” label on the bottom. Examine the logo and finish for any differences from official images on the Hydro Flask website. Test the bottle’s insulation by filling it with cold water and checking for exterior condensation. Genuine bottles should remain dry on the outside. Inspect the lid and rubber ring for quality and fit. Authentic products use sturdy materials that do not fall out or break easily.

Alternatives
Similar Brands
Consumers seeking bottles with performance and design similar to Hydro Flask can choose from a wide range of reputable brands. Each brand offers unique features that cater to different preferences and needs.
- Yeti Rambler stands out for its durability and wide handles. The bottle feels heavier and bulkier, but it resists dents and maintains cold temperatures for at least 24 hours.
- S’well provides sleek aesthetics and strong insulation. The bottle lacks handles and comes at a higher price point, appealing to those who value style.
- Klean Kanteen offers both insulated and non-insulated bottles. The brand features narrow-mouth and wide-mouth options, with narrow-mouth designs providing better insulation and affordability.
- Takeya Actives includes insulated lids and attached spout covers, making it easy to use and clean.
- FJbottle integrates a magnet to keep the spout cap out of the way and features a rigid handle with a carrying strap.
- CamelBak bottles use magnetic spout caps and offer a budget-friendly option, though some design trade-offs exist.
- ThermoFlask delivers mid-range pricing and similar insulation performance.
- Iron Flask presents a budget alternative with multiple lids, though lid quality may vary.
- Ozark Trail provides excellent insulation and a grippy base, but availability is limited.
- Stanley Quencher features a large side handle and tapered base for cup holders, though it is bulkier and not leak-proof.
- Owala matches Hydro Flask in portability and cold retention, with a base diameter that fits most cup holders.
Preferred features among these brands include interchangeable lids, ergonomic handles, leak-proof designs, and a smooth drinking experience. Most alternatives use vacuum insulation to keep beverages hot or cold for extended periods.
Other Manufacturing Locations
Most insulated water bottles come from factories in China, including those from Yeti, S’well, Klean Kanteen, and Takeya. These brands rely on Chinese manufacturers for their expertise, scale, and advanced production capabilities. For example, Yeti bottles are produced in China, while S’well and Klean Kanteen also source from Chinese factories. Some brands, such as Klean Kanteen, have explored manufacturing in India and the United States for select products, but the majority of their insulated bottles still originate from China.

Buying Tips
What to Look For
Selecting a high-quality water bottle requires attention to several essential features. Buyers should prioritize safety, durability, and convenience. The following checklist outlines the most important factors:
- Material and Durability: Choose bottles made from food-grade stainless steel, such as 18/8 (304) or 316 grades. These materials resist corrosion and ensure long-term use. Avoid bottles made from 201 stainless steel or plastics containing BPA.
- Size and Capacity: Select a bottle that matches daily hydration needs. Compact bottles suit portability, while larger sizes work for extended activities.
- Insulation and Temperature Control: Double-wall vacuum insulation keeps beverages hot or cold for hours. This feature is vital for maintaining drink temperature throughout the day.
- Design and Portability: Consider mouth size for cleaning and drinking ease. Leak-proof lids and carrying handles or carabiners add convenience.
- Easy Maintenance: Wide-mouth openings and dishwasher-safe construction simplify cleaning.
- Lid Construction: Ensure lids are BPA-free and leak-proof for safety and reliability.
- Certifications: Look for FDA and LFGB certifications to confirm food contact safety.

Importance of Origin
The country of origin can influence the safety and durability of a water bottle. Manufacturing standards, environmental regulations, and material quality vary by region. China produces most stainless steel water bottles worldwide, benefiting from advanced production capabilities and skilled labor. Reputable Chinese manufacturers who follow international standards, such as FDA, LFGB, and ISO 9001, deliver safe and durable products. However, relaxed regulations in some factories may lead to the use of unsafe additives or lower-quality metals.
Countries like the United States and those in Europe enforce stricter environmental and safety regulations. These standards often result in higher production costs but can improve product quality and reduce pollution. Buyers should check for accurate labeling, including country of origin and safety certifications, to ensure reliability. Ultimately, a manufacturer’s commitment to quality control and transparency matters more than the country itself.
